87 1.46 christos /*
88 1.46 christos * Credentials.
89 1.46 christos *
90 1.46 christos * A subset of this structure is used in kvm(3) (src/lib/libkvm/kvm_proc.c)
91 1.46 christos * and should be synchronized with this structure when the update is
92 1.46 christos * relevant.
93 1.46 christos */
94 1.46 christos struct kauth_cred {
95 1.53 ad /*
96 1.53 ad * Ensure that the first part of the credential resides in its own
97 1.53 ad * cache line. Due to sharing there aren't many kauth_creds in a
98 1.53 ad * typical system, but the reference counts change very often.
99 1.53 ad * Keeping it seperate from the rest of the data prevents false
100 1.53 ad * sharing between CPUs.
101 1.53 ad */
102 1.46 christos u_int cr_refcnt; /* reference count */
103 1.56 ad uint8_t cr_pad[CACHE_LINE_SIZE - sizeof(u_int)];
104 1.55 ad uid_t cr_uid; /* user id */
105 1.46 christos uid_t cr_euid; /* effective user id */
106 1.46 christos uid_t cr_svuid; /* saved effective user id */
107 1.46 christos gid_t cr_gid; /* group id */
108 1.46 christos gid_t cr_egid; /* effective group id */
109 1.46 christos gid_t cr_svgid; /* saved effective group id */
110 1.46 christos u_int cr_ngroups; /* number of groups */
111 1.46 christos gid_t cr_groups[NGROUPS]; /* group memberships */
112 1.46 christos specificdata_reference cr_sd; /* specific data */
113 1.46 christos };

924 1.2 elad /*
925 1.2 elad * Authorize a request.
926 1.2 elad *
927 1.2 elad * scope - the scope of the request as defined by KAUTH_SCOPE_* or as
928 1.2 elad * returned from kauth_register_scope().
929 1.2 elad * credential - credentials of the user ("actor") making the request.
930 1.2 elad * action - request identifier.
931 1.2 elad * arg[0-3] - passed unmodified to listener(s).
932 1.2 elad */
933 1.2 elad int
934 1.2 elad kauth_authorize_action(kauth_scope_t scope, kauth_cred_t cred,
935 1.2 elad kauth_action_t action, void *arg0, void *arg1,
936 1.2 elad void *arg2, void *arg3)
937 1.2 elad {
938 1.2 elad kauth_listener_t listener;
939 1.2 elad int error, allow, fail;
940 1.2 elad
941 1.26 elad KASSERT(cred != NULL);
942 1.26 elad KASSERT(action != 0);
943 1.2 elad
944 1.17 christos /* Short-circuit requests coming from the kernel. */
945 1.17 christos if (cred == NOCRED || cred == FSCRED)
946 1.17 christos return (0);
947 1.17 christos
948 1.26 elad KASSERT(scope != NULL);
949 1.26 elad
950 1.2 elad fail = 0;
951 1.2 elad allow = 0;
952 1.39 elad
953 1.44 ad /* rw_enter(&kauth_lock, RW_READER); XXX not yet */
954 1.2 elad SIMPLEQ_FOREACH(listener, &scope->listenq, listener_next) {
955 1.2 elad error = listener->func(cred, action, scope->cookie, arg0,
956 1.44 ad arg1, arg2, arg3);
957 1.2 elad
958 1.2 elad if (error == KAUTH_RESULT_ALLOW)
959 1.2 elad allow = 1;
960 1.2 elad else if (error == KAUTH_RESULT_DENY)
961 1.2 elad fail = 1;
962 1.2 elad }
963 1.44 ad /* rw_exit(&kauth_lock); */
964 1.2 elad
965 1.39 elad if (fail)
966 1.39 elad return (EPERM);
967 1.39 elad
968 1.39 elad if (allow)
969 1.39 elad return (0);
970 1.39 elad
971 1.39 elad if (!nsecmodels)
972 1.39 elad return (0);
973 1.39 elad
974 1.39 elad return (EPERM);
975 1.2 elad };
